🔑 shoeBrE /ʃuː/NAmE /ʃuː/ noun🔑
one of a pair of outer coverings for your feet, usually made of leather or plastic a pair of shoes 一双鞋He took his shoes and socks off. 他脱掉鞋袜。What's your shoe size? 你穿多大的鞋?a shoe brush 鞋刷shoe polish 鞋油   see also snowshoe
= horseshoe
be in sb's shoesput yourself in sb's shoesto be in, or imagine that you are in, another person's situation, especially when it is an unpleasant or difficult one 处于某人的境地;设身处地I wouldn't like to be in your shoes when they find out about it. 等他们弄清事情真相的时候,你的日子就很不好过了。if ˌI were in ˈyour shoesused to introduce a piece of advice you are giving to sb (引出建议)要是我处在你的境地,换了我是你的话If I were in your shoes, I'd resign immediately. 要是我处在你的地位,我就立刻辞职。if the shoe fits (, wear it)(NAmE) (BrE if the cap fits (, wear it)) if you feel that a remark applies to you, you should accept it and take it as a warning or criticism 有则改之the shoe is on the other ˈfoot(NAmE) (BrE the boot is on the other ˈfoot) used to say that a situation has changed so that sb now has power or authority over the person who used to have power or authority over them 情况正好相反;宾主易位fill sb's shoes/bootsto do sb's job in an acceptable way when they are not there 妥善代职shake in your ˈshoes(informal) to be very frightened or nervous 非常害怕(或紧张);战战兢兢;心惊肉跳step into sb's ˈshoesto continue a job or the work that sb else has started 接替某人的工作
🔑 shoeBrE /ʃuː/NAmE /ʃuː/ verbpresent simple - I / you / we / they shoe BrE /ʃuː/ NAmE /ʃuː/present simple - he / she / it shoes BrE /ʃuːz/ NAmE /ʃuːz/past simple shod BrE /ʃɒd/ NAmE /ʃɑːd/past participle shod BrE /ʃɒd/ NAmE /ʃɑːd/ -ing form shoeing BrE /ˈʃuːɪŋ/ NAmE /ˈʃuːɪŋ/~ sthto put one or more horseshoes on a horse 给(马)钉蹄铁The horses were sent to the blacksmith to be shod. 马送到铁匠那儿钉马掌去了。
